    Mesothelioma Compensation Claims

    Compensation claims for mesothelioma can reimburse victims of their medical expenses, lost income and discomfort and pain. It also covers funeral costs and losses associated with the rare asbestos disease.

    Most mesothelioma claims stem from exposure to asbestos while at work. Compensation can be sought from the companies responsible for that exposure, as these cases are almost always the result of corporate negligence.

    Most people with mesothelioma will have health insurance that covers a portion of the costs. However copays for mesothelioma-related treatments are typically higher than the cost of other types of cancer-related treatments. Compensation can help families afford treatments.

    Asbestos-related injuries may also qualify you for worker's comp. There are time limits on filing a claim for worker's compensation. Moreover, workers' comp benefits are usually modest in comparison to the typical mesothelioma settlement, or trial verdict.

    A lawsuit could result in a mesothelioma settlement - https://sunpgm.com,, and a jury could decide the amount of the compensation if the case goes to trial. The majority of mesothelioma cases settle prior to trial.

    Compensation from a lawsuit settlement is usually tax-free. Tax implications can result from a verdict by a jury for punitive damages. It is crucial to speak with an experienced tax lawyer before making a decision on any compensation.

    The majority of people suffering from asbestos-related diseases have been exposed in the workplace. A lot of these workers were employed in industries like shipbuilding construction, manufacturing, and oil & gas. During this period, asbestos was used in the production of products and to line buildings for fire protection. Unfortunately, these companies failed to warn their employees of the dangers of exposure to asbestos.
